Swimming and Diving Hosts Olive & Blue Scrimmage This Saturday
Oct 3, 2025 | Women's Swimming and Diving
NEW ORLEANS – The Tulane swimming and diving team officially gets back in the pool as the program hosts the Olive & Blue Scrimmage on Saturday, Oct. 4, starting at 9 a.m. at the Reily Center Natatorium. The event is open to the public so fans can get a sneak preview of the program in action before next week's start of the regular season.

Tulane's program, under the direction of Head Coach Amanda Caldwell, was picked for fourth in the 2025-26 American Preseason Poll with 35 points.
Â
Next, the team begins the regular season with a two-day dual meet against Liberty from Oct. 10-11 at the Reily Student Recreation Center. It is the first of three home meets this season as the program also hosts Rice on Nov. 7 and the Mardi Gras Invite from Jan. 16-17. The program will also travel and visit the states of Texas (Denton – Oct. 25 & Houston – Nov. 19-21), Florida (Sarasota – Dec. 13 & Pensacola – Jan. 24), Nevada (Las Vegas – Dec. 15-17) and California (San Diego – Dec. 30 – Jan. 5) during the regular season. The squad also makes a trip to Baton Rouge on Nov. 8. The 2026 American Championships are in Greensboro, North from Feb. 18-21. The NCAA Zones are from March 8-11, the NIC Championships are from March 12-14 in Ocala, Fla. while the NCAA Championships are from March 18-21 in Atlanta, Georgia
The program finished the 2024-25 season with 54 top 10 school marks including 10 school records. The team also won six events, had 28 overall all conference marks, a placing of third overall at the league championship meet plus saw Head Coach Amanda Caldwell along with her staff being named the American's Coaching Staff of the Year. The program also had 10 qualify to participate in the National Championship Invitational this season, three divers that earned bids to the Zone D Diving Championship, had four swimmers named to the Academic All-District by the College Sports Communicators and six that were CSCAA Scholar All-Americans. Additionally the program had nine NCAA 'B' cuts, placed fifth at the CSCAA Open Water Championships and rack up 10 American Conference Weekly honors (five swimmers of the week, two freshman swimmers of the week, two freshman divers of the week and one conference diver of the week).
